OSX

  • Go -> Connect to Server
  • In the Server Address box type the address of the server (optional press the + sign to add it to the list)
  • Press Connect

IsilonFaculty1Capture.PNG

  • Select Registers User
  • Enter you columbia username faculty need to prefix the name with ***ad600\*** is i would be ad600\jmeyers
  • Enter your password (Same as email password)

IsilonFaculty2Capture.PNG

  • Contrats your now connected to Isilon check you desktop for finder for the share volume
  • OPTIONAL follow the steps below to add the Isilon share so that i reconnects when you logon

Windows

  • Open windows explorer by clicking "My Computer" or (windows key + e)
  • Paste the link in to windows explorer
  • If the windows machine is joined to the domain and you logon with a domain account it should just connect. IF not you may need to do map network drive (right click my computer and select Map Network Drive)
